Notice of Making Borough of Torbay

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984, Section 14 (1) - Temporary Parking Restrictions (The Strand: Harbour Public Realm) Order 2023

Notice is hereby given that Torbay Council has made a temporary order under the provisions of Section 14 of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984, the effect of which is to introduce temporary measures in the following specified roads in Torquay, as follows:- No stopping at any time except for local buses - Torwood Street. Taxi stand no stopping at any time except for taxis - Vaughan Road.

The Order is considered necessary to provide suitable locations for a temporary bus stop and taxi rank whilst works are ongoing for The Strand Harbour Public Realm.

The Order will come into force on 21st December 2023 and will continue in force until for a period not exceeding 18 months, or until such time that the works are completed. It is anticipated that the works will be completed by September 2024

Documents giving more detailed particulars of the order, which includes plans illustrating the lengths of road affected, may be inspected between 9:00am and 5:00pm each working day at the Torbay Council Connections Office, Paignton Library and Information Centre, Great Western Road, Paignton, TQ3 3HZ.

The documentation may also be viewed online at the following web address: www.torbay.gov.uk/proposedtros

Date: 20th December 2023
